oborowy

Polish

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ɔ.bɔˈrɔ.vɨ/

Etymology 1

From obora + -owy.

Adjective

oborowy

  1. (relational) cowshed
    Synonym: oborny
Declension

Noun

oborowy m pers (feminine oborowa)

  1. A person in charge of a cowshed.
Declension

Etymology 2

From obór + -owy.

Adjective

oborowy

  1. (obsolete, relational) selection, election
